1. Japanese Government (MEXT) Scholarships
The Japanese Government, through the Ministry of Education, Culture, Sports, Science and Technology (MEXT), offers a variety of scholarships for international students. These include scholarships for undergraduate, graduate, and specialized training programs. MEXT Scholarships cover tuition, monthly stipends, travel expenses, and insurance, making them one of the most comprehensive funding opportunities for foreign students in Japan.
- Eligibility: International students with excellent academic records and proficiency in Japanese or English, depending on the program.
- Application Process: Typically coordinated through Japanese embassies in your home country or directly through Japanese universities.
2. JASSO Scholarships for International Students
The Japan Student Services Organization (JASSO) provides scholarships to support international students living and studying in Japan. These scholarships often include monthly stipends and are particularly helpful for students who need additional support beyond tuition.
- Student Exchange Support Program (JASSO): Designed for students participating in short-term exchange programs.
- Monbukagakusho Honors Scholarship: Offered to high-performing students, this scholarship provides monthly financial support without requiring repayment.

9. Monbukagakusho Honors Scholarship
The Monbukagakusho Honors Scholarship is highly prestigious and supports outstanding international students pursuing higher education in Japan. It provides financial stability, enabling students to focus on studies without financial distraction.
- Coverage: Monthly stipends without repayment obligations.
- Selection Criteria: Academic excellence, leadership qualities, and potential contributions to society.
10. Student Exchange Support Program (JASSO)
The Student Exchange Support Program (JASSO) provides scholarships specifically for international students involved in exchange programs. This program facilitates cultural and academic exchange while ensuring financial support.
- Duration: Typically for one semester to one academic year.
- Support Provided: Monthly stipends, travel allowances, and accommodation support.
